What Does It Mean to Rekey Your Locks?

Rekeying is the process of replacing the internal mechanism of a lock so that it can be operated by a new key while the old key becomes obsolete. Unlike changing the entire lock system, the ranking is more cost-effective and it is safe when it is done correctly. The Rekeying Process: What to Expect

The Recking process for a professional locksmith is relatively straight. What happens here usually:

Evaluation and key expulsion


Locksmith will begin by assessing the type of locks you have. Then they will remove the lock cylinder and remove the old pin inside the lock.

New key cutting


The new pin is inserted into the lock cylinder, which matches the cut on a new key. This ensures that only the new key will operate only the lock.

Restoration and test


The lock cylinder is then re-installed, and the new key is tested to ensure that it works easily. The old keys will no longer work, which gives you a safe, updated lock system.
